Merissa (12934 KP) rated Baby's Got Bite (Take It Like a Vamp #2) in Books
Apr 14, 2023
It tells the story of a one-night stand that went either really wrong or absolutely perfectly, depending on which way you look at it. To begin with, Bennett looks at it as "How the hell did this happen?" but quickly gets a handle on it and deals with it. Her first stop is to let Linc know, whose reaction is pretty much the same but not for the reasons that Bennett thinks. Things move rapidly between the two of them and a lot is mentioned about how they will be in danger if people find out, due to who Linc is and his connections with Nick.
This is a well-written book with a fast-paced plot. It is full of humour and witty banter between Linc and Bennett which makes the whole thing a delight to read. Definitely recommended.

Laura Doe (1350 KP) rated If We’re Not Married By Thirty in Books
May 2, 2022
This is the second book that I have read by Anna Bell and her humour is poured into her books and her characters are just so loveable!
This book is definitely based around something that I think most people my age have done, which is make a pact with a friend about if you’re not both married or in a relationship by a certain age, then you will both get together. I think everyone makes the same pact thinking that it’s years and years away so it will never happen, and soon life creeps up on you and before you know it you’ve reached that age!
I loved the characters in this book and rooted for Lydia every step of the way. Although the book was predictable, it didn’t take away from how much I enjoyed it. Although the best characters were definitely the two mothers.
After enjoying two of Anna Bell’s books, I will definitely be looking at buying more that she has written. They are just good old rom-com chick lits, perfect for when you just need a bit of a giggle.
